Buying guide — what actually matters for best portable potty for car

When you're on the hunt for the perfect portable potty for your car, it’s easy to get overwhelmed by all the options. But really, it boils down to a few key things that will make your life so much easier. Think of it less as buying a toilet and more as investing in peace of mind for your travels.

Portability and Stash-ability

This is probably the most crucial factor for a car potty. You need something that folds down small enough to fit in your trunk, a corner of the backseat, or even a large diaper bag without becoming a tripping hazard. Look for models that collapse flat or into a compact shape and ideally come with their own carrying case. A case not only keeps everything tidy but also helps contain any residual smells or moisture.

Ease of Setup and Cleanup

Picture this: your toddler urgently needs to go, you're on the side of the road, and it's starting to rain. You don’t have time for a complicated assembly process. Great portable potties unfold quickly and easily, often in just seconds. Cleanup is just as vital.

Options that work with disposable liners or bags are fantastic for on-the-go hygiene, allowing you to tie them off and dispose of them later. If it's a model you need to wipe down, make sure the surfaces are smooth and easy to sanitize with baby wipes or a quick rinse.

Stability and Safety for Little Ones

A wobbly potty is a recipe for disaster and can make a child nervous about using it. When used as a standalone seat, look for a base that has a wide footprint or non-slip feet to prevent it from sliding. If it's designed to go over a standard toilet seat, check that it fits securely and doesn't shift easily. The seat itself should be comfortable for a child, not too big, not too small, and ideally have a slightly raised edge or splash guard, especially for boys, to prevent errant messes.

Children's comfort is paramount; if they don't feel secure, they won't use it.

Durability and Material Quality

Even though these are portable, they still need to hold up to regular use and life in a car. Opt for potties made from durable, BPA-free plastic that can withstand temperature fluctuations common in vehicles. While budget models are often perfectly adequate, a slightly more robust build can mean a longer lifespan and better performance over time. You want something that feels sturdy enough to support your child confidently, use after use.

Included Accessories (Liners, Bags, Cases)

Many portable potties come bundled with helpful extras. Disposable liners or potty bags are a huge convenience, as they contain waste and make cleanup much simpler. A dedicated travel bag is also a big plus for keeping everything organized and your car tidy. While these accessories can add to the overall value, also consider the ongoing cost if liners need to be purchased separately.

Having a good starter set can make a big difference from day one.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Is a portable potty really necessary for car trips?

Yes, a portable potty can be incredibly useful for car trips, especially with toddlers or young children who are potty training. It provides a hygienic and convenient solution for unexpected bathroom needs, eliminating the stress of finding a public restroom or the discomfort of a mid-trip emergency stop. It’s a practical tool that offers peace of mind for parents, allowing for more relaxed travel.

How do I clean a portable potty after use?

Cleaning methods vary slightly depending on the type of portable potty. For models that use disposable liners or bags, you simply tie the liner securely and dispose of it properly. For reusable potties, wipe down all surfaces with antibacterial wipes or a damp cloth. Many are made from smooth plastic that's easy to sanitize.

It’s always a good idea to have a small trash bag and sanitizing wipes handy for immediate cleanup on the go.

Can a portable potty be used on a standard toilet seat?

Many portable potties are designed to do double duty: they can be used as a standalone seat on the floor or in the car, and also placed directly on top of a standard adult toilet seat. These models usually have a slightly smaller opening and a stable base to fit securely over most regular toilet seats, providing a more child-friendly and hygienic surface for potty training.

What is the weight limit for most portable potties?

The weight capacity for portable potties can vary, but most are designed for toddlers and young children. Generally, they can support anywhere from 40 to 50 pounds. Some more robust models, like the TRIPTIPS, are designed with adjustable height and a higher weight capacity, intended for older children or even adults in emergency situations, often supporting up to 300 pounds. Always check the product specifications for the exact weight limit.
